Peermaid,[1] also spelled Peer Maid[2] was a traditional Chandrilan role in which young Chandrilan girls accompany noble offspring through their daily life. They often help with chores as well as provide friendship and guidance.[1] In 4 BBY, a number of Leida Mothma's peermaids attended her wedding with Stekan Sculdun at the Mothma Estate on Chandrila. On the first day of the wedding, Leida led a group of them to see her wedding gown.[3]
Behind the scenes
Peermaids first appeared, though unidentified in the eleventh episode, "Daughter of Ferrix", of the first season of the live-action series Star Wars: Andor. They were later identified in the subtitles and credits the first episode of the second season of the series, "One Year Later," which was released on Disney+[3] on April 22, 2025.[4] Two peermaids were included in the episode's credits, peermaid 1 and peermaid 2, portrayed by Brooke Holmewood and Nuala Peberdy respectfully.[3]
